#6574E7 Color
#6574E7 is rgb(101, 116, 231) in RGB, hsl(233, 73%, 65%) in HSL, and about cmyk(56%, 50%, 0%, 9%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Royal Blue (#4169E1),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.9.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#6574E7 Channel Values
How #6574E7 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 101 · G 116 · B 231 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 233° · S 73% · L 65%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 233° · S 56% · V 91%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 56% · M 50% · Y 0% · K 9%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.03:1 vs white · 5.21: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#6574E7 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#6574E7 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#6574E7?
#6574E7 is a light blue — rgb(101, 116, 231) in RGB and hsl(233, 73%, 65%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Royal Blue (#4169E1),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.9.
What is the RGB value of #6574E7?
#6574E7 is rgb(101, 116, 231) — red 101, green 116, and blue 231 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#6574E7?
#6574E7 converts to approximately cmyk(56%, 50%, 0%, 9%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#6574E7 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#6574E7 scores 4.03:1 against white and 5.21: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#6574E7 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#6574E7 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is royalblue (#4169E1) at a CIE76 distance of 7.9,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
